THE SOUTHERN CROSS - Ski in Chile

Added in 2004, our Southern Cross itinerary is geared for advanced and expert –level skiers and snowboarders looking to summit and ski/ride volcanoes in Chile's Lake District. This tour is ideal for skiers and snowboarders who want to get off the beaten path, earn their turns and experience some of the most beautiful zones of Southern Chile. This 12 day tour starts in Pucon, where we attempt to climb Chile’s most active volcano, Volcan Villarrica, then works north to Volcano Lonquimay OR Volcan Llaima to summit and ski these remote peaks, and finishes with four days at Nevados de Chillan, our favorite resort in South America with 3 volcanoes rising above its lifts.

Join us on our Southern Cross adventure through Chile’s Ring of Fire, skiing and snowboarding snow- covered volcanoes while challenging yourself in one of the more remote areas of the Andes.

Participants must be in good to excellent physical condition, and be advanced to expert level skiers / snowboarders.

Trip Itinerary

Day 1 - ARRIVE SANTIAGO - FLY TO TEMUCO/PUCON

Arrive Santiago Int’l airport where you will be met by your CASA guides. When scheduling flights, please be sure to arrive before 10:00 AM. We will make a quick connection flight to the city of Temuco where your CASA vans will be waiting to take you to Pucon (1.5 hours drive). Pucon lies nestled in the shadow of Volcan Villarrica, Chile’s most active volcano.

Pucon has lots of great restaurants and bars - “Mamas and Tapas” is a great place to sit by the fire and chat with locals and international travelers alike. Our cozy lodgings at Cabañas Ruca-Malal includes wood-burning stoves and lies only a short walk from downtown.

Days 2-3 - SUMMIT VOLCAN VILLARRICA

We will have two days for our summit attempt on Villarrica, allowing us some flexibility for the right weather conditions. This 4 to 6 hour guided climb is not technical, but is strenuous. Upon reaching the summit of the active volcano, you can look deep into a monstrous, steaming caldera and watch lava spurt into the sky! On a clear day, you can see across the peaks of the Andes all the way to Argentina. Views from Villarrica are some of the most beautiful in all of Chile, a vista of the surrounding volcanoes and lakes. To get down, click in, strap on, and commence carving.

Whichever day we do not spend hiking the volcano, we will ride the lifts at the ski resort built on lower slopes of Villarrica, skiing the intricate lava flows and natural half pipes. Pucon also offers some of the most amazing hotsprings in the world, perfect to soak our tired bones.

Day 4 - TRAVEL TO LONQUIMAY OR LLAIMA

On the morning of Day 4, we will make a decision based on weather and snow forecasts - head to Lonquimay or Llaima? The town of Lonquimay, a beautiful destination serving the Volcano Lonquimay, is way off the beaten toursit path. Our comfortable home, The Andean Rose, is located along the banks of the Rio Cautin. Llaima is equally remote, in an araucaria forest. Both volcanoes are incredibly beautiful, and offer great backcountry adventure.

Days 5-6 - SUMMIT LONQUIMAY / LLAIMA

At Lonquimay, we spend 2 days visiting the off the beaten track resort, Corralco. With the right conditions, we will make a 2 to 4 hour summit attempt to get a truly spectacular view of the surrounding Andes. OR - at Llaima, we will spend two days exploring the resort Araucarias, riding the lifts, hitching rides on snowcats into the backcountry, and watching the weather for an opportunity to summit Volcan Llaima, a 3 to 5 hour climb into the heavens.

Day 7 - TRAVEL TO TERMAS DE CHILLAN

On day seven, we will journey north to the city of Las Trancas, near the resort at Termas de Chillan. Spend the day watching the Chilean countryside and let your legs recover from all the fun. The Salto del Laja, an impressive waterfall, is a great place to stop and snap some pictures. The city of Chillan, one hour from our final destination, is noted for having Chile’s finest artesan market. We will stop there to have a meal and wander the marketplace before continuing on to Las Trancas.

Days 8-11 - SKI/RIDE/ SUMMIT NEVADOS DE CHILLAN

We will spend four days staying in the comfort of our CASA casa, Cabañas Los Andes. These private cabins will serve as our home base while exploring the stellar terrain and backcountry at Nevados de Chillan. Chillan is known for having consistently the best snow conditions in Chile and is generally the highlight of all our Chilean tours.

Within the span of the four days we will tour amazing off-piste terrain, waiting for the right conditions to mount summit attempts on Volcan Chillan and the adjacent Volcan Nevados de Chillan. Both Volcanoes offer breathtaking views and some of the best skiing in all of South America. Our last night includes an “asado” - Chilean BBQ. Enjoy the traditional steak, chicken and sausage prepared by our Chilean hosts.

Day 12 - RETURN TO SANTIAGO - DEPARTURE

On Day 12 we will roadtrip back to Santiago in time for flights home - please schedule your flight departure for after 5:00 PM. Chao amigos!
